    Major Duties

    • Serves as the organizational leader by establishing direction, setting priorities, managing workload, securing resources, and providing guidance to staff.
    • Manages the full range of supervisory responsibilities including recruitment, performance standards, evaluations, discipline, EEO oversight, training, safety, and employee engagement.
    • Directs the identification, documentation, and implementation of automation requirements, ensuring compliance with DoD and DLA standards for application development and operations.
    • Oversees HR information systems projects by securing resources, establishing milestones, monitoring progress, resolving issues, and ensuring successful completion of objectives.
    • Provides technical and functional guidance to HR stakeholders, maintains system-related communications and web content, and ensures staff are trained to support HR program and technical functions.

    Qualification Summary

    To qualify for a Supervisory Human Resources Specialist (Information Systems), your resume and supporting documentation must support: Specialized Experience: One year of specialized experience that equipped you with the particular competencies to successfully perform the duties of the position, and that is typically in or related to the position to be filled. To qualify at the GS-14 level, applicants must possess one year of specialized experience equivalent to the GS-13 level or equivalent under other pay systems in the Federal service, military or private sector. Applicants must meet eligibility requirements including time-in-grade (General Schedule (GS) positions only), time-after-competitive appointment, minimum qualifications, and any other regulatory requirements by the cut-off/closing date of the announcement. Creditable specialized experience includes: Directing automation projects involving requirements analysis, design, development, and implementation of HR information systems in compliance with DoD and DLA standards. Managing supervisory functions including recruitment, performance evaluations, discipline, EEO oversight, training, and employee engagement for subordinate staff. Overseeing project management activities to establish milestones, secure resources, monitor progress, and ensure completion of HR systems initiatives. Providing expert technical and functional guidance to HR stakeholders on system capabilities, limitations, and impacts to planned initiatives. Ensuring communication and training effectiveness by preparing technical guidance, maintaining system-related web content, and supporting staff proficiency in HR program and technical functions. Experience refers to paid and unpaid experience, including volunteer work done through National Service programs (e.g., Peace Corps, AmeriCorps) and other organizations (e.g., professional, philanthropic, religious, spiritual, community, student, social). Volunteer work helps build critical competencies, knowledge, and skills and can provide valuable training and experience that translates directly to paid employment. You will receive credit for all qualifying experience, including volunteer experience.
